HIS 338 - Colonial America Credits: 3


Explores changing patterns of life in North America from the late 15th century to the mid-18th century. Themes examined include the European exploration and settlement of the Americas, the demographic and ecological consequences of colonization, and the development of distinct regional cultures in colonial America.

Prerequisite(s): (HIS 105   or HON 122   ) and (HIS 106   or HON 123   ) and (HIS 201   or HIS 202   ) or permission of instructor
